This 1440 clock-hour program prepares graduates to pass the Board of Nursing NCLEX licensing exam and work as an LPN in a variety of health care settings. The program offers a day 44-week program offered in Bellefontaine and Urbana, and a satellite program at the Kenton North Campus. A 72-week dual enrollment PN to RN program is offered in partnership with Clark State Community College at the Marysville location.
Pre-requisite courses in anatomy and physiology and computer applications are required before the start of first quarter classes. Instruction includes concurrent clincial experiences at area health facilities for nursing principles, medical-surgical nursing, maternal/infant health, gerontology, pediatric nursing, IV therapy, and pharmacology. Additional coursework includes nutrition, microbiology, mental health and illness, and growth and development.
